What is Category B?
Category B, frequently described as the "car and little van" category, is a type of driving license that permits the holder to drive lorries as much as 3,500 kilograms (kg) in weight, including little vans and pickup. This category is especially crucial for individuals who require to drive for individual or professional factors, as it covers most of automobiles utilized in daily life.
The Application Process
Eligibility Requirements
Age: Applicants should be at least 17 years of ages to look for a provisional license and 17 years and 6 months old to take the dry run.Residency: Zakup Prawa jazdy Applicants need to be homeowners of the nation where they are making an application for the license.Health: Applicants must meet the minimum health and eyesight standards set by the licensing authority.
Provisionary License
Before taking the dry run, applicants need to initially obtain a provisional driving license. This can be done online, by post, or in person at a designated workplace.The provisionary license permits the candidate to practice driving with a certified trainer or a certified driver who is at least 21 years old and has actually held a complete driving license for a minimum of three years.
Theory Test
The theory test is an essential step in the process. It includes two parts: a multiple-choice section and a risk perception test.Multiple-Choice Section: This part evaluates the applicant's understanding of the Highway Code, roadway indications, and safe driving practices. The test consists of 50 questions, and applicants must score at least 43 out of 50 to pass.Danger Perception Test: This area examines the applicant's ability to recognize and react to prospective threats on the road. The test consists of 14 video, and applicants must score at least 44 out of 75 to pass.
Dry run
Once the theory test is passed, the candidate can book a practical driving test. Q: What is the minimum age to use for a Category B driving license?
A: The minimum age to apply for a provisionary license is 17 years of ages, and the minimum age to take the useful test is 17 years and 6 months old.
Q: Can I drive a motorcycle with a Category B license?
A: No, a Category B license does not cover motorbikes. You would need a separate motorbike license (Category A) to drive a motorcycle.
